Canon 5D III, Canon 24-105 f4L, ISO 50, f14, 1/10th sec, tripod.
I’ve just returned from leading a basecamp trip for Arctic Wild to the eastern portion of the Arctic National Wildlife Refuge along the Kongakut River. We camped for a week near Whale Mountain. While the wildlife was not as abundant as we had hoped, the weather and the scenery were spectacular. I made this image a short walk from camp, facing up river.
